Former Sydney Swan leading goalkicker Jason Love, in his role as coach of North Cairns Tigers, started an all-in brawl after the national anthem on Saturday in the Cairns AFL Grand Final.
In disgraceful scenes numbers of team officials and supporters were also involved which led to 2 Port Douglas players unable to start the game.
Definitely revived memoeries of 1987 and 1991 Sydney GFs for me.
The umps unsure what to do just started the game without the siren going off ... which actually stopped things!
Such a pity ... because the competition is actually of pretty good standard. I guess on the positive side of the things, the mighty Cairns City Cobras will probably win a few games early in the season next year because of suspension.
For the record, North Cairns won the GF by about 50 points ... reversing a 65 point loss in the Major Semi.
